Faith with Obedience Brings Healing

Jesus went to the sheep market in Jerusalem, which is right near the pool called Bethesda (Jn. 5:1-16). The word “Bethesda” means, the house of mercy, but to many it was a house of misery. In verse 1 John links this miracle with the healing of the nobleman’s son in the previous chapter. Having dealt there with human doubt, Jesus now prepares to deal with human disability.

1. A Sad Group Of People

A group of sick and sad people were around the pool. Perhaps, they were rejected by doctors and forsaken by the relatives and the society.

The Failure Behind Our Failures

Napoleon Hill said, “There are three kinds of people in the world- The wills, The wont’s and The cant’s. The first accomplish everything, the second oppose everything and the third fail in everything.” Failure is one of the negative aspects of life. We deny it, run away from it or upon being over taken, fall into permanent paralysing fear.

Probably our reluctance to face it is the failure behind our failures.
